Warning Signs You Need Water Heater Burst Water Removal

Catching the warning signs of a burst water heater early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ent musty odors can show hidden water damage. If you notice a lingering smell,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ent mold growth and structural damage.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leaky water heater. If you notice water stains or discoloration on your ceiling or walls, it’s crucial to investigate the source of the leak and take action quickly.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age. If you notice your flooring is looking uneven or damaged,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ent further damage.

Increased Water Bills

Increased water bills can be a sign of a leaky water heater. If you notice your water bills are higher than usual, it’s crucial to investigate the source of the leak and take action quickly.

Leaks Under Your Sink or Around Fixtures

Leaks under your sink or around fixtures can be a sign of a burst water heater. If you notice water leaking from these areas,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ent further damage.

Unusual Noises Coming from Your Water Heater

Unusual noises coming from your water heater can be a sign of a problem. If you notice strange noises, it’s crucial to investigate further to prevent a burst water heater.

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ost In Boca Grande, FL

The cost of water heater burst water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Boca Grande, FL. Our prices are estimates, not guarantees, and may vary based on the specifics of your situation.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to restore your home.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Drying and monitoring $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, number of drying equipment used
Cleaning and dis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used
Restoration and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used
Containment and barrier setup $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of materials used
Moisture detection and inspection $100 – $500 Size of affected area, number of inspections required
